Biography

Dr. K. Kathiravan is currently working as Assistant Professor at Department of Biotechnology, University of Madras, India. He earned his PhD in Biotechnology in Department of Biotechnology from Bharathidasan University, India and Post Doctorate from the Volcani Center, Agriculture Research Organization, Bet-Dagan, Israel. Previously he was appointed as Research Associate at Department of Biotechnology, Bharathidasan University, Scientist at Entomology Research Institute, Loyola College, Chennai, and Lecturer at Department of Biotechnology, Jamal Mohamed College, Tiruchirapalli. Dr. Kathiravan received honors includes Junior Research Fellowship awarded by World Bank Sponsored Central Silk Board Project at Bharathidasan University, Trichy, Research Associate awarded by CSIR, Young Scientist Project Awarded, SERC Visiting fellowship Awarded by Department of Science & Technology, Ministry of Science & Technology, Government of India, New Delhi, DBT NICHE Overseas Fellowship Visiting fellowship awarded. He has completed 5 research projects. He has published 44 research articles in journals, 3 abstracts in journals, 9 articles in books and 22 Genbank Submission contributed as author/co-author. He also presented number of papers in conferences. He is member of Animal Ethical Committee Member-Institutional Animal Ethical Committee (IAEC), University of Madras, Guindy Campus, Chennai, Biosafety Committee Member in Institutional Biosafety Committee (IBSC), Entomology Research Institute, Loyola College, and Bio-Safety committee member in Vanta Biosciences, Gummidipundi, Tamil Nadu, India.
